小编给大家分享一下css中位移翻译()的使用方法,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获、下面让我们一起去了解一下吧!
一:翻译()用法
在css样式中,很多人都喜欢使用翻译()来表示位移,可以使用翻译()中的x和y来表示元素在水平方向或者垂直方向上移动。
例如:1. translateY (y):表示该元素在垂直方向上移动,也就是我们所说的y轴
2. translateX (x):表示该元素在水平方向上移动,也就是我们所说的x轴
二:翻译()语法
变换:translateX (x),或者变换:translateY (y);
在css3中,变换属性的变形方法都是属于变换,并且要加上变换,从而表示变形处理,元素在水平方向中移动的距离的单位用px和百分比表示,当x出现正值的时候,表示元素在水平方向右有移动,当x为负值的时候,表示该元素向左移动,
例如:
& lt; !DOCTYPE html> & lt; html xmlns=癶ttp://www.w3.org/1999/xhtml"比; & lt; head> & lt; title> CSS3位移翻译()方法& lt;/title> & lt;风格类型=拔谋?css"比;/*设置原始元素样式*/#起源 { 保证金:100 px汽车;/*水平居中*/宽度:200 px; 身高:100 px; 边界:1 px冲银; }/*设置当前元素样式*/目前# { 宽度:200 px; 身高:100 px; 颜色:白色; background - color: # 3 edff4; text-align:中心; 变换:translateX (50 px); -webkit-transform: translateX (20 px);/*兼容webkit -引擎浏览器*/-moz-transform: translateX (20 px);/*兼容-moz——引擎浏览器*/} & lt;/style> & lt;/head> & lt; body> & lt; div id=皁rigin"祝辞 & lt; div id=癱urrent"祝辞& lt;/div> & lt;/div> & lt;/body> & lt;/html>
效果如下:
总结:变换:translateX (50 px)说明在水平方向上移动50 px,这时候我们如果我们把50 px改成-50 px,该元素就在水平方向相反的方向移动50 px。
翻译(y)的用法:
翻译(y)的用法和翻译(x)的用法很相似,x是在水平方向上移动,y是在垂直方向上移动,当
y出现正值的时候,说明该元素在向下移动,如果出现负值,说明是向上移动,和我们的正常思维相反。
翻译(x, y)的混合使用:
表示元素在x中水平方向上移动,这里需要注意的是,y值是一个参数,没有设置y的值话,可能表示元素在x轴移动,其实单纯的使用翻译()是没有太多的意义,我们可以结合css使用。
以上是css中位移翻译()的使用方法的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注行业资讯频道!